by Kristina Rasmussen

While standing in a very long line at the Post Office yesterday, I noticed this placard advertising their PhotoStops Kit. Basically, you get to put a photo of your choice on a legit stamp.

We all know that USPS is facing major fiscal issues. Things are bad. So bad, apparently, that they’re asking customers NOT to use their product. From that placard:

PhotoStamps Kits are a great gift for the person who has everything. The PhotoStamps themselves make a great memorial if framed. [my emphasis]


I get philatelics and the collecting vibe, but really, frame a set of stamps featuring the photo you paid to add to them? An unredeemed product is pure cash for the Post Office. And they sure seem to need more of that nowadays.
